Copper has face centered cubic (fcc) lattice with interatomic spacing equal to 2.54Å. The value of lattice constant for this lattice is
Options
(a) 2.54 Å
(b) 3.59 Å
(c) 1.27 Å
(d) 5.08 Å
Correct Answer:
3.59 Å
Explanation:
Lattice constant for C = r₀ × √2 = 2.54 × 1.414 = 3.59 Å
